African Minerals Limited announced the appointment of Stephan Weber as the Group's Chief Operating Officer with effect from 1 February 2013. Mr. Weber (aged 51) joins AML from Anglo American, where he was chief executive officer of Anglo American Iron Ore Brazil, and was also a member of Anglo American's group executive committee. In this role, which he held from mid-2009, he was responsible for the commissioning and ramp-up of the 6.5Mtpa Amapá Iron Ore system incorporating a mine, 200km rail, and port, as well as overseeing the $6 billion 26.5Mtpa Minas Rio project.

Prior to his most recent role with Anglo American, he was managing director of Rio Tinto's "HIsmelt" division. In this role, he was also a member of the executive committee of Rio Tinto Iron Ore.
